We speak with Jeffrey Marriner, Regional Manager for Spectur.

Spectur delivers autonomous, reliable and effective systems that allow for faster and often immediate responses.

Spectur deplys advanced solar-powered and AI enabled surveillance capabilities to provide fast automatic detection and response to potential threats, delivering security when people cannot be present. Solar security and surveillance camera systems alert first responders to human and vehicle activity only, minimising false alarms, while emitting a loud and bright warning onsite to send intruders running.
